Onboard — Auto Project Analysis (index)

When to use

  • Analysing an existing project to propose the right agents, hooks, and primitives for its stack.
  • First-time KeiSeiKit setup on a project: scan → score → propose → apply artefacts.
  • Adding KeiSeiKit coverage to a project that has grown beyond its original scope.

You are analysing an existing project (or a scope of projects) and proposing the right kit artefacts for it: project-specialist agents, stack-specific hooks, and install-time primitives.

This skill is a proposer + applier, not a manifest writer. It scans, scores, proposes, and then delegates each accepted candidate to the existing pipeline:

  • Agents → handoff to /new-agent (the 8-phase wizard)
  • Hooks + rules → handoff to /escalate-recurrence
  • Primitiveskei-sleep-queue add (or direct install.sh --add= suggestion in the final report)

This SKILL.md is the INDEX. Each phase lives in its own file and runs in strict order. Never skip or re-order phases.


Prerequisite check

Before Phase 1, verify the kit baseline is present:

  • ~/.claude/skills/new-agent/SKILL.md (or the kit-shipped skills/new-agent/SKILL.md) — required for agent delegation
  • ~/.claude/skills/escalate-recurrence/SKILL.md — required for hook/rule delegation
  • ~/.claude/skills/compose-solution/SKILL.md — required only when a proposed candidate crosses artefact boundaries

If any are missing, stop and tell the user: "Install KeiSeiKit v0.12+ first (run install.sh --profile=dev from the kit repo)." Do not fall through.

Rules (apply throughout)

  • RULE 0.4 (NO HALLUCINATION). Phase-1 scan uses exact grep/ls output. If grep returns nothing for a framework, mark it as "not detected". Never invent a framework based on directory names or README prose alone. Confidence grade (E3-E4 for scan-derived, never E1-E2).
  • RULE 0.8 (SECRETS). Never read actual .env or secrets/*.env files. Read only .env.example, .env.template, and schema files. The env-var surface in Phase 1b is the list of KEY names, never values.
  • RULE 0.13 (NO GIT). This skill does not invoke git. The orchestrator (or the user in a follow-up turn) handles commits.
  • NO DOWNGRADE. Any phase that fails returns 2-3 constructive paths, never "can't be done". Example: scan finds no lockfile → propose "(A) Ask user to specify stack, (B) Scan for code-file extensions, (C) Skip stack-specialisation, propose generic agent only".
  • Plan Mode First. This skill IS the plan; each phase has a verify-criterion. No Edit/Write before the corresponding phase's confirm click.
  • Constructor Pattern. Each phase file is a single cube. This index stays ≤200 LOC; phase files each ≤150 LOC. Candidates that exceed complexity budget at application time are split — never stuffed into one manifest.
  • Surgical Changes. Onboard writes nothing directly — all writes are delegated to /new-agent, /escalate-recurrence, or kei-sleep-queue. The only in-place artefacts onboard produces are ephemeral scan summaries displayed in the conversation.
